Ethics & Accountability
As the charitable foundation of the Canadian Paediatric Society, Healthy Generations upholds high ethical standards. Our success depends on public trust, confidence and support.
The CPS is accountable to a wide range of stakeholders, including its members, the wider health care community, its sponsors, and the Canadian public, who look to the CPS to help make decisions about child and youth health. Because of its relationship with the CPS, Healthy Generations is also subject to the CPS Code of Ethics.
